WebD7 Chord On The Guitar (D Dominant 7) – Diagrams, Finger Positions and Theory. The D7 (D dominant 7) chord contains the notes D, F#, A and C. It is produced by taking the root (1), 3, 5 and b7 of the D Major scale. WebThe D# Major chord contains the notes D#, Fx and A#. The D# chord is produced by playing the 1st (root), 3rd and 5th notes of the D# Major scale.
